Technical Specifications
  • Voltage: 400V
  • Frame Size: 100 mm
  • Magnet Stack Length: 50.8 mm
  • Maximum Speed: 5000 RPM
  • Encoder Type: 1024 SIN/COS absolute multi-turn (Hiperface)
  • Connector: Circular (Speedtec) DIN
  • Brake: 24V DC holding brake
  • Shaft: Keyed, no shaft seal
  • Dimensions (H x L x W): 100mm x 150mm x 100mm
  • Weight: 3.5 kg
